PM Modi Flags Off India's First Vande Bharat Sleeper Train, Boosts Bengal Connectivity
- •PM Modi flagged off India's first Vande Bharat sleeper train between Howrah and Guwahati (Kamakhya) from Malda Town Station, West Bengal.
- •He also digitally flagged off the return journey of the Guwahati-Howrah Vande Bharat sleeper train and interacted with students.
- •The Prime Minister inaugurated rail and road projects worth over Rs 3,250 crore in West Bengal, including four Amrit Bharat Express trains.
- •The Vande Bharat sleeper train offers a "flight-like travel experience at an affordable price," reducing Howrah-Guwahati travel time by 2.5 hours.
- •PM Modi emphasized that these projects will accelerate Bengal's progress, strengthen connectivity, and boost tourism and employment.
